Architecture Digest
May 31, 2017 · Operations
Designing Distributed Transaction Architecture and Ensuring Data Consistency in a Flow Recharge System
The article explains how to break large transactions into small atomic operations combined with asynchronous messaging, describes ACID properties, presents banking and flow‑recharge scenarios, compares local and distributed (flexible) transactions, and details micro‑service architecture, compensation and async strategies to achieve eventual consistency.
System Architectureasynchronous notificationcompensation
0 likes · 11 min read